Nico Harrison Creates ‘Best Front Line’ in NBA After Cooper Flagg Get

Well, hated Mavericks GM Nico Harrison did it. He drafted Duke sensation Cooper Flagg as the No.1 overall pick in the hopes of creating a new era for Dallas.

Once Flagg was drafted, Harrison was asked by the media if he thinks the criticism he faced after the bombshell Luka Doncic trade will quieten down now that the team has landed a star like Flagg.

“I’m hoping so,” Harrison said with a small smile. “I’m assuming so, a little bit maybe.”

It may take some more time, since Mavs fans at the Dallas watch party were still chanting ‘Fire Nico’. Yikes.

Despite Dallas fans holding a grudge, Longtime NBA insider Shams Charania is a big fan of what Nico is doing in Dallas.

“Whatever you want to say about the Luka Doncic trade, Nico Harrison has built arguably the best front line in the NBA,” Shams declared. “You think about Anthony Davis. Now Cooper Flagg. Dereck Lively II. They just extended Daniel Gafford on a new three-year, almost $60 million deal.

“The biggest key of this season is going to be Kyrie Irving. If he was healthy right now, we’d probably be talking about this team with the Oklahoma City Thunder, competing for a championship.”

The controversial GM says the team is excited the team is to land such a unique prospect.

“It’s a generational talent, a once-in-a-lifetime chance,” Harrison said. “So just top to bottom, we’re excited.”

Harrison went on to say he thinks Flagg will make an impact on both ends of the floor.

“I think the biggest thing is he’s a two-way player,” Harrison said. “When you watch him play, he plays hard. … When you have a player that’s that good and people talk about the intangibles — they don’t talk about basketball — then that’s a guy who’s going to add to your culture.”
